Output 8622c1626465088a5a891718af4d13d8ca0bfdacc2bc2936493769d92d7655f1:0

value
552158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 448241f599afefbd883b357c1d4c8737f3a5732a OP_EQUAL
address
37wFv3mzeXGfjWs3YHXHafT1zevPNZya37
transaction
8622c1626465088a5a891718af4d13d8ca0bfdacc2bc2936493769d92d7655f1
confirmations
213293
spent
true